From 365714a01e6e561432dfed4c9ca42a8fb601b91e Mon Sep 17 00:00:00 2001 From: Daniel Schmidt Date: Mon, 10 Feb 2025 16:48:20 +0100 Subject: [PATCH] move main branch changie directory name to dev --- .changes/README.md | 10 +++++++++ .changes/{unreleased => dev}/.gitkeep | 0 .../BUG FIXES-20250123-135228.yaml | 0 .../BUG FIXES-20250123-150746.yaml | 0 .../BUG FIXES-20250210-163038.yaml | 0 .../ENHANCEMENTS-20250123-101838.yaml | 0 .../ENHANCEMENTS-20250203-170319.yaml | 0 .../ENHANCEMENTS-20250204-182544.yaml | 0 .../ENHANCEMENTS-20250205-104144.yaml | 0 .../dev/ENHANCEMENTS-20250206-162053.yaml | 5 +++++ .../ENHANCEMENTS-20250206-34969.yaml | 0 .../ENHANCEMENTS-20250207-164803.yaml | 0 .../UPGRADE NOTES-20250212-36478.yaml | 0 .changie.yaml | 3 +-- CHANGELOG.md | 21 +++++++++++++++++++ 15 files changed, 37 insertions(+), 2 deletions(-) create mode 100644 .changes/README.md rename .changes/{unreleased => dev}/.gitkeep (100%) rename .changes/{unreleased => dev}/BUG FIXES-20250123-135228.yaml (100%) rename .changes/{unreleased => dev}/BUG FIXES-20250123-150746.yaml (100%) rename .changes/{unreleased => dev}/BUG FIXES-20250210-163038.yaml (100%) rename .changes/{unreleased => dev}/ENHANCEMENTS-20250123-101838.yaml (100%) rename .changes/{unreleased => dev}/ENHANCEMENTS-20250203-170319.yaml (100%) rename .changes/{unreleased => dev}/ENHANCEMENTS-20250204-182544.yaml (100%) rename .changes/{unreleased => dev}/ENHANCEMENTS-20250205-104144.yaml (100%) create mode 100644 .changes/dev/ENHANCEMENTS-20250206-162053.yaml rename .changes/{unreleased => dev}/ENHANCEMENTS-20250206-34969.yaml (100%) rename .changes/{unreleased => dev}/ENHANCEMENTS-20250207-164803.yaml (100%) rename .changes/{unreleased => dev}/UPGRADE NOTES-20250212-36478.yaml (100%) diff --git a/.changes/README.md b/.changes/README.md new file mode 100644 index 0000000000..0f89a5960d --- /dev/null +++ b/.changes/README.md @@ -0,0 +1,10 @@ +# Changelog process + +We use [Changie](https://changie.dev/) to manage our changelog. +We support PRs to three branches, which all have their own changelog folders: + +- **N-1**: latest maintenance release -> `.changes/current` +- **N**: upcoming release -> `.changes/next` +- **N+1**: next release -> `.changes/dev` + + diff --git a/.changes/unreleased/.gitkeep b/.changes/dev/.gitkeep similarity index 100% rename from .changes/unreleased/.gitkeep rename to .changes/dev/.gitkeep diff --git a/.changes/unreleased/BUG FIXES-20250123-135228.yaml b/.changes/dev/BUG FIXES-20250123-135228.yaml similarity index 100% rename from .changes/unreleased/BUG FIXES-20250123-135228.yaml rename to .changes/dev/BUG FIXES-20250123-135228.yaml diff --git a/.changes/unreleased/BUG FIXES-20250123-150746.yaml b/.changes/dev/BUG FIXES-20250123-150746.yaml similarity index 100% rename from .changes/unreleased/BUG FIXES-20250123-150746.yaml rename to .changes/dev/BUG FIXES-20250123-150746.yaml diff --git a/.changes/unreleased/BUG FIXES-20250210-163038.yaml b/.changes/dev/BUG FIXES-20250210-163038.yaml similarity index 100% rename from .changes/unreleased/BUG FIXES-20250210-163038.yaml rename to .changes/dev/BUG FIXES-20250210-163038.yaml diff --git a/.changes/unreleased/ENHANCEMENTS-20250123-101838.yaml b/.changes/dev/ENHANCEMENTS-20250123-101838.yaml similarity index 100% rename from .changes/unreleased/ENHANCEMENTS-20250123-101838.yaml rename to .changes/dev/ENHANCEMENTS-20250123-101838.yaml diff --git a/.changes/unreleased/ENHANCEMENTS-20250203-170319.yaml b/.changes/dev/ENHANCEMENTS-20250203-170319.yaml similarity index 100% rename from .changes/unreleased/ENHANCEMENTS-20250203-170319.yaml rename to .changes/dev/ENHANCEMENTS-20250203-170319.yaml diff --git a/.changes/unreleased/ENHANCEMENTS-20250204-182544.yaml b/.changes/dev/ENHANCEMENTS-20250204-182544.yaml similarity index 100% rename from .changes/unreleased/ENHANCEMENTS-20250204-182544.yaml rename to .changes/dev/ENHANCEMENTS-20250204-182544.yaml diff --git a/.changes/unreleased/ENHANCEMENTS-20250205-104144.yaml b/.changes/dev/ENHANCEMENTS-20250205-104144.yaml similarity index 100% rename from .changes/unreleased/ENHANCEMENTS-20250205-104144.yaml rename to .changes/dev/ENHANCEMENTS-20250205-104144.yaml diff --git a/.changes/dev/ENHANCEMENTS-20250206-162053.yaml b/.changes/dev/ENHANCEMENTS-20250206-162053.yaml new file mode 100644 index 0000000000..9e20b9cbf7 --- /dev/null +++ b/.changes/dev/ENHANCEMENTS-20250206-162053.yaml @@ -0,0 +1,5 @@ +kind: ENHANCEMENTS +body: "Terraform Test: Continue subsequent test execution when an expected failure is not encountered." +time: 2025-02-06T16:20:53.83763+01:00 +custom: + Issue: "34969" diff --git a/.changes/unreleased/ENHANCEMENTS-20250206-34969.yaml b/.changes/dev/ENHANCEMENTS-20250206-34969.yaml similarity index 100% rename from .changes/unreleased/ENHANCEMENTS-20250206-34969.yaml rename to .changes/dev/ENHANCEMENTS-20250206-34969.yaml diff --git a/.changes/unreleased/ENHANCEMENTS-20250207-164803.yaml b/.changes/dev/ENHANCEMENTS-20250207-164803.yaml similarity index 100% rename from .changes/unreleased/ENHANCEMENTS-20250207-164803.yaml rename to .changes/dev/ENHANCEMENTS-20250207-164803.yaml diff --git a/.changes/unreleased/UPGRADE NOTES-20250212-36478.yaml b/.changes/dev/UPGRADE NOTES-20250212-36478.yaml similarity index 100% rename from .changes/unreleased/UPGRADE NOTES-20250212-36478.yaml rename to .changes/dev/UPGRADE NOTES-20250212-36478.yaml diff --git a/.changie.yaml b/.changie.yaml index 098dc6fbae..6bb03d6742 100644 --- a/.changie.yaml +++ b/.changie.yaml @@ -1,9 +1,8 @@ # Copyright (c) HashiCorp, Inc. # SPDX-License-Identifier: BUSL-1.1 - changesDir: .changes -unreleasedDir: unreleased +unreleasedDir: dev versionFooterPath: version_footer.tpl.md changelogPath: CHANGELOG.md versionExt: md diff --git a/CHANGELOG.md b/CHANGELOG.md index b07f9ec237..30d293140c 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-1,6 +1,27 @@ ## 1.12.0 (Unreleased) + +ENHANCEMENTS: + +* Terraform Test command now accepts a -parallelism=n option, which sets the number of parallel operations in a test run's plan/apply operation. ([#34237](https://github.com/hashicorp/terraform/issues/34237)) + +* Logical binary operators can now short-circuit ([#36224](https://github.com/hashicorp/terraform/issues/36224)) + +* Terraform Test: Runs can now be annotated for possible parallel execution. ([#34180](https://github.com/hashicorp/terraform/issues/34180)) + +* Allow terraform init when tests are present but no configuration files are directly inside the current directory ([#35040](https://github.com/hashicorp/terraform/issues/35040)) + +* Terraform Test: Continue subsequent test execution when an expected failure is not encountered. ([#34969](https://github.com/hashicorp/terraform/issues/34969)) + + +BUG FIXES: + +* Refreshed state was not used in the plan for orphaned resource instances ([#36394](https://github.com/hashicorp/terraform/issues/36394)) + +* Fixes malformed Terraform version error when the remote backend reads a remote workspace that specifies a Terraform version constraint. ([#36356](https://github.com/hashicorp/terraform/issues/36356)) + + EXPERIMENTS: Experiments are only enabled in alpha releases of Terraform CLI. The following features are not yet available in stable releases.